      By the close of the 1960’s, Lloyd ‘Charmers’ Tyrell was firmly established as one of Jamaica’s premier talents, having previously made his mark as a key member of leading vocal outfits, The Charmers and The Uniques.

      His move into record production in 1968 swiftly resulted in numerous Jamaican hits, with his success attracting the attention London-based reggae music giant, Trojan Records, with whom he swiftly signed a licensing deal in 1969. As the ‘60s drew to a close, Trojan released ‘Reggae Is Tight’, on which the multi-talented Charmers demonstrated his keyboard-playing talents over a dozen fast-passed rhythm tracks. This is from the golden age of boss reggae sounds. A must for all true fans of vintage Jamaican sounds.
